The Durability of Chain Link for Commercial Security

One of the primary reasons local businesses choose chain link is its incredible resilience. In the Gulf Coast environment, moisture and salt spray can wreak havoc on lesser materials. Most modern chain link systems feature galvanized coatings or vinyl finishes that resist rust and corrosion for decades. This durability ensures that your investment in commercial security continues to perform year after year without needing constant repairs or expensive paint jobs.

Because the mesh design allows wind to pass through easily, chain link fences often fare better during the high-wind events common in our area. Unlike solid privacy fences that act like sails during a tropical storm, chain link stands firm. This structural integrity means your perimeter remains intact when you need it most, providing peace of mind during the stormy season.

Visibility and Effective Commercial Security

A critical component of any safety plan is the ability to see what is happening on both sides of the fence line. Chain link offers clear sightlines that solid barriers simply cannot match. This transparency allows your staff or security team to monitor the surrounding area for suspicious activity from a distance. Furthermore, law enforcement officers patrolling the area at night can easily see onto your property, which significantly increases the effectiveness of your commercial security measures.

High visibility also integrates perfectly with secondary security systems. If you utilize surveillance cameras or motion sensors, a chain link fence ensures there are no “blind spots” where an intruder might hide. By combining physical barriers with clear lines of sight, you create a comprehensive defense strategy that protects your equipment, inventory, and employees.

Customizing Fences for Better Commercial Security

Not every business has the same needs, and chain link is remarkably easy to customize. Depending on the level of risk your facility faces, we can adjust the height, gauge, and features of the fence to meet specific requirements. For example, a standard six-foot fence might work for a small retail parking lot, but a high-risk industrial site might require an eight-foot or ten-foot barrier.

To further enhance your commercial security, we can add specialized features to the top of the fence. Options such as barbed wire or razor wire provide a significant psychological and physical deterrent to anyone attempting to climb the structure. We also install heavy-duty gates, including cantilever or overhead track systems, to ensure that the entry points of your property are just as secure as the rest of the perimeter.
